Great Caesar's Ghost... and Snakes!!!

For the last 2 nights, Mema has seen ghosts in her room.  Yesterday morning she told me she had a nightmare the night before (good that she recognized it as such, because most times she doesn't).  She said there was a ghost sitting on top of her bookshelf.  "It sat there silently," she said, "but if it's going to be in my room, at least it should talk to me!"

She also woke up at one time, and thought there were snakes in her room.  Turns out her fan was on oscillate, and when it blew towards her chair, it was flapping the coverlet she had on the chair, which was undulating very snake-like!!!

Last night Mema came into our room at 1:15 a.m. (I had JUST gotten into a deep sleep).  She had left her walker in her room and held onto the walls to get to our room.  She said there was something outside and a ghost was looking in the window.  "Not the whole ghost, but just the head," she said.  I turned on the light on the deck and opened the curtain to show her there was nothing outside.  However, it was raining and there was heavy thunder & lightning.  I told her that must be what she saw.

She then said that there was a car in the yard with it's lights shining in her window.  Again I told her, "It's just the lightning, Mema.  There is nowhere for a car in the backyard... it's just woods."

She sat on the bed and told me she was scared,  "I need a hug."  I hugged her and reassured her there was nothing outside, just the rainstorm, thunder & lightning, and that she was just having a nightmare again.  I told her that she could come sleep in our bed or on the sofa in my room, if she would like, but she asked me to leave her door open instead (she NEVER sleeps with the door open!).  I kissed her & hugged her goodnight again, and left the door wide open.

Manicures & Tornados!!!

Tuesday was hot, humid... sultry is what it was.  You know the kind of day that your makeup is sliding off your face and when you try to peel off your clothes to take a cool shower they stick to you?  Yeah, that kinda day! The forecast was for late afternoon and evening thunderstorms.

Mema & I had 5:30 appointments for manicures, and it was getting a little cloudy before we left, but I was confident we'd be home in and hour - hour 1/2, tops - at least before the storm hit.   Randi's station is by the window, and as I am wont to do, I was watching the birds hopping around looking for bugs, and a young rabbit munching on grass.  It got hazier, then more cloudy, and as the final top coat was being applied, we hear a strange sound, "What is that?" I asked.  "Not sure," said Randi.  "It kinda sounds like a siren, but I'll go check and see."

She didn't come back... not a good sign!  So I got up & went to the reception area, where everyone was watching the TV.  "What is it?  A tornado?"  "Yes!  A funnel cloud has been spotted near Damon's!"  
OH CRAP!!!  We live about a 1/2 mile away from there!!!

Then the cell phones go off!  Randi's 12 year old daughter called her and told her she was at a friend's whose Dad was there, and they were in the basement.  Then her husband called and told her that she had ~10 minutes to get somewhere safe, as the storm was moving fast and was about 10 miles west of Midland.  YIKES!!!

She helped me get Mema's walker into the trunk; "Buckle up Mema!" and we zoomed outta there!  Luckily we were only 5 minutes from home.  As we were driving, we saw lightning strike in the same place, which looked like the mall and airport area, 7 different times!!!  One of the bolts looked like someone was flipping a light switch: on & off, on & off, on & off, SIX times!!!  Another bolt looked like a portion of it was missing, ~ 1/3 from the uppermost end!  Very strange!

We made it into the house with only 5 minutes to spare before the sky opened up!  Charlie, my Cocker Spaniel who was already in hiding, slunk out of the bedroom.  Where can we go?  Not the basement, as there's no WAY to get Mema down there by myself, much less back up!!!  I thought the best place will be in the shower in my bathroom as it is an interior room with no windows; however, there is a honking big mirror over the double sinks, and of course the shower door, but it is big enough that we could all fit and Mema's shower chair is in there too, so she could sit.

BOOM!!!  A torrential downpour gushed out of the sky!  Mema asked if I was going to close the curtains of the sliding glass door to the deck, but I told her, no, because otherwise I wouldn't know what's happening.  I'd rather know if it's coming so we could take cover!  TV 5's Storm Center interrupted programming, and showed video of the ominous cloud over Damon's.  Soon the rain let up and the storm passed; we heard no more sirens. Thank God!  That was a close one!!!
